20 #ifndef __GTK_TREE_MODEL_H__
21 #define __GTK_TREE_MODEL_H__
22
23 #include <gtk/gtkobject.h>
24
25 #ifdef __cplusplus
26 extern "C" {
27 #endif /* __cplusplus */
28
29 #define GTK_TYPE_TREE_MODEL            (gtk_tree_model_get_type ())
30 #define GTK_TREE_MODEL(obj)            (G_TYPE_CHECK_INSTANCE_CAST ((obj), GTK_TYPE_TREE_MODEL, GtkTreeModel))
31 #define GTK_IS_TREE_MODEL(obj)         (G_TYPE_CHECK_INSTANCE_TYPE ((obj), GTK_TYPE_TREE_MODEL))
32 #define GTK_TREE_MODEL_GET_IFACE(obj)  ((GtkTreeModelIface *)g_type_interface_peek (((GTypeInstance *)GTK_TREE_MODEL (obj))->g_class, GTK_TYPE_TREE_MODEL))
33
34 typedef struct _GtkTreeIter         GtkTreeIter;
35 typedef struct _GtkTreePath         GtkTreePath;
36 typedef struct _GtkTreeRowReference GtkTreeRowReference;
37 typedef struct _GtkTreeModel        GtkTreeModel; /* Dummy typedef */
38 typedef struct _GtkTreeModelIface   GtkTreeModelIface;
39
40
41 typedef enum
42 {
43   GTK_TREE_MODEL_ITERS_PERSIST = 1 << 0
44 } GtkTreeModelFlags;
45
46 struct _GtkTreeIter
47 {
48   gint stamp;
49   gpointer user_data;
50   gpointer user_data2;
51   gpointer user_data3;
52 };
53
54 struct _GtkTreeModelIface
55 {
56   GTypeInterface g_iface;
57
58   /* Signals */
59   void         (* changed)           (GtkTreeModel *tree_model,
60                                       GtkTreePath  *path,
61                                       GtkTreeIter  *iter);
62   void         (* inserted)          (GtkTreeModel *tree_model,
63                                       GtkTreePath  *path,
64                                       GtkTreeIter  *iter);
65   void         (* has_child_toggled) (GtkTreeModel *tree_model,
66                                       GtkTreePath  *path,
67                                       GtkTreeIter  *iter);
68   void         (* deleted)           (GtkTreeModel *tree_model,
69                                       GtkTreePath  *path);
70   void         (* reordered)         (GtkTreeModel *tree_model,
71                                       GtkTreePath  *path,
72                                       GtkTreeIter  *iter,
73                                       gint         *new_order);
74
75   /* Virtual Table */
76   GtkTreeModelFlags (* get_flags)  (GtkTreeModel *tree_model);   
77
78   gint         (* get_n_columns)   (GtkTreeModel *tree_model);
79   GType        (* get_column_type) (GtkTreeModel *tree_model,
80                                     gint          index);
81   gboolean     (* get_iter)        (GtkTreeModel *tree_model,
82                                     GtkTreeIter  *iter,
83                                     GtkTreePath  *path);
84   GtkTreePath *(* get_path)        (GtkTreeModel *tree_model,
85                                     GtkTreeIter  *iter);
86   void         (* get_value)       (GtkTreeModel *tree_model,
87                                     GtkTreeIter  *iter,
88                                     gint          column,
89                                     GValue       *value);
90   gboolean     (* iter_next)       (GtkTreeModel *tree_model,
91                                     GtkTreeIter  *iter);
92   gboolean     (* iter_children)   (GtkTreeModel *tree_model,
93                                     GtkTreeIter  *iter,
94                                     GtkTreeIter  *parent);
95   gboolean     (* iter_has_child)  (GtkTreeModel *tree_model,
96                                     GtkTreeIter  *iter);
97   gint         (* iter_n_children) (GtkTreeModel *tree_model,
98                                     GtkTreeIter  *iter);
99   gboolean     (* iter_nth_child)  (GtkTreeModel *tree_model,
100                                     GtkTreeIter  *iter,
101                                     GtkTreeIter  *parent,
102                                     gint          n);
103   gboolean     (* iter_parent)     (GtkTreeModel *tree_model,
104                                     GtkTreeIter  *iter,
105                                     GtkTreeIter  *child);
106   void         (* ref_node)        (GtkTreeModel *tree_model,
107                                     GtkTreeIter  *iter);
108   void         (* unref_node)      (GtkTreeModel *tree_model,
109                                     GtkTreeIter  *iter);
110 };

138 /* Row reference (an object that tracks model changes so it refers to the same
139  * row always; a path refers to a position, not a fixed row).  You almost always
140  * want to call gtk_tree_row_reference_new.
141  */
142
143 GtkTreeRowReference *gtk_tree_row_reference_new       (GtkTreeModel        *model,
144                                                        GtkTreePath         *path);
145 GtkTreeRowReference *gtk_tree_row_reference_new_proxy (GObject             *proxy,
146                                                        GtkTreeModel        *model,
147                                                        GtkTreePath         *path);
148 GtkTreePath         *gtk_tree_row_reference_get_path  (GtkTreeRowReference *reference);
149 void                 gtk_tree_row_reference_free      (GtkTreeRowReference *reference);
150
151 /* These two functions are only needed if you created the row reference with a
152  * proxy object */
153 void                 gtk_tree_row_reference_inserted  (GObject     *proxy,
154                                                        GtkTreePath *path);
155 void                 gtk_tree_row_reference_deleted   (GObject     *proxy,
156                                                        GtkTreePath *path);
157 void                 gtk_tree_row_reference_reordered (GObject     *proxy,
158                                                        GtkTreePath *path,
159                                                        GtkTreeIter *iter,
160                                                        gint        *new_order);
